Transaction c491bfae23f83b3ad50a1de6d7fe4e8385c98fd2a2f1833c09bb6a3e72b1462c
2 Input
2 Outputs
- c491bfae23f83b3ad50a1de6d7fe4e8385c98fd2a2f1833c09bb6a3e72b1462c:0
- c491bfae23f83b3ad50a1de6d7fe4e8385c98fd2a2f1833c09bb6a3e72b1462c:1
value 20000000
address 12uRWe9jv6CopHBgne6imQq45ndPX6r4sV
value 126931776
address 3C94CgYEkwcf7RSma742WptNY36NAQ2Ab2